SQL数据库的日志管理是确保数据库系统稳定运行和数据安全的重要环节。通过有效管理日志,可以快速定位和解决问题、优化数据库性能、进行安全审计以及监控数据库的运行状况。以下是SQL数据库日志管理的一些关键...
在SQL中进行数据库迁移是一个涉及多个步骤的过程,需要仔细规划和执行。以下是一些关键步骤和注意事项: ### 准备工作 - **数据备份**:在开始任何迁移操作之前,确保已备份所有重要数据。使用`...
保证SQL数据库的安全性是一个多方面的任务,涉及多个层面的措施。以下是一些关键的步骤和最佳实践: ### 常见的安全威胁及应对措施 - **SQL注入攻击**:通过输入验证和参数化查询来防止。 -...
在 SQL 中,创建数据库用户的方法因数据库管理系统(DBMS)而异 **MySQL:** ```sql CREATE USER 'new_user'@'localhost' IDENTIFIED...
SQL数据库分区是一种数据库技术,它允许将一个大型的表分成多个较小的、更易于管理的部分,这些部分被称为分区。每个分区在逻辑上都是表的一部分,但在物理存储上,每个分区可以有自己的存储引擎、文件、索引等。...
提升SQL数据库的性能是一个多方面的任务,涉及到数据库的设计、索引优化、查询优化、硬件配置调整等多个方面。以下是一些有效的性能提升方法: ### 索引优化 - **创建合适的索引**:在经常用于查...
要在SQL中恢复数据库,请按照以下步骤操作: 1. 确保已经创建了数据库的备份文件。这是恢复数据库所必需的。 2. 打开SQL Server Management Studio (SSMS),并连接...
在SQL数据库中,备份是确保数据安全性和业务连续性的关键操作。以下是SQL数据库备份的详细步骤和策略: ### 备份步骤 1. **使用SQL Server Management Studio (...
在 SQL 中管理数据库,通常包括创建、修改和删除数据库 1. 创建数据库: 要在 SQL 中创建一个新的数据库,可以使用 `CREATE DATABASE` 语句。例如,要创建名为 "my_dat...
SQL 数据库索引是一种用于快速查找表中特定行的数据结构 创建和使用索引可以提高查询性能,但也需要注意其维护成本。因为在插入、删除或更新操作时,数据库需要自动更新索引,这会消耗额外的系统资源。所以,...